Lake Fork Report 2/15/16 #11415993 02/15/16 10:45 PM

Hey everyone,
Just wanted to give a quick Lake Fork report for those of ya'll coming out soon. The weather looks great for the rest of the week and should make for some great fishing.
The lake level is currently at 402.28, which is about 3/4ths of a foot low. The water temp has ranged from 52-58 degrees depending where you are on the lake. Those temps are going to get higher this week with the warm weather we are experiencing.
The fishing has really picked up for me in the last few days and I expect it to just get better. I've been focusing on shallow flats with coontail or any kind of grass with ditches and creek channels running through them. The fish have been pushing up in the the warm, shallow water on these flats and seem to be moving around in pods. When we get a bite, i'll drop my power poles and really pick apart the area. It seems like whenever we catch one we are able to pick up a few more in the same 20-30 yard area.
Baits that have been working best for me have been red or gold lipless crankbaits, 3/8 & 1/2 oz black brown & amber Santone Rattlin jigs with a Smash Tech craw trailer in black neon, weightless black flukes and 1/2 ounce white and chartruse chatterbaits. This morning I was able to catch a couple of nice unders and some small slot fish on a mans baby -1 crankbait in fire tiger.
As the water gets warmer these fish will start to get up on the bank where you can catch them on wacky worms, texas rigged lizzards, 3/8 oz santone rattling jigs and santone swim jigs with a smash tech smash tail jr trailer.
